Sharepoint 2010 如何在SPGridview中使用当前项目id
您能告诉我如何在SPGridView中的NavigateURL中使用当前项目id吗。 下面是代码示例。如果我使用Eval,它会给出运行时错误。 在这种情况下请帮助我Sharepoint 2010 如何在SPGridview中使用当前项目id,sharepoint-2010,spgridview,Sharepoint 2010,Spgridview,您能告诉我如何在SPGridView中的NavigateURL中使用当前项目id吗。 下面是代码示例。如果我使用Eval,它会给出运行时错误。 在这种情况下请帮助我 <SharePoint:SPGridView runat="server" ID="gdvSearchResults" width="50%" AllowSorting="True" AutoGenerateSelectButton="false" AutoGenerateColumns="false">
<SharePoint:SPGridView runat="server" ID="gdvSearchResults" width="50%" AllowSorting="True"
AutoGenerateSelectButton="false" AutoGenerateColumns="false">
<Columns>
<SharePoint:SPBoundField runat="server" DataField="Attachments" HeaderText="Attachments" SortExpression="Attachments" />
<SharePoint:SPBoundField runat="server" DataField="Practice" HeaderText="Practice" />
<asp:HyperLinkField DataTextField="ID" HeaderText="Require_x0020_Details_x0020__x00" NavigateUrl="http://server/sites/TestingCollection/TestLists/Send%20Mail/EditForm.aspx?ID="+ID/>
</Columns>
</SharePoint:SPGridView>
提前谢谢 使用我的网格中的以下更改解决了此问题
<SharePoint:SPGridView runat="server" ID="gdvSearchResults" width="50%" AllowSorting="True"
AutoGenerateSelectButton="false" AutoGenerateColumns="false">
<Columns>
<SharePoint:SPBoundField runat="server" DataField="Attachments" HeaderText="Attachments" SortExpression="Attachments" />
<SharePoint:SPBoundField runat="server" DataField="Practice" HeaderText="Practice" />
<asp:HyperLinkField DataNavigateUrlFields="ID" DataNavigateUrlFormatString="~/EditForm.aspx?ID={0}" DataTextField="ID" HeaderText="ID" />
</Columns>
</SharePoint:SPGridView>